by UKPhilTR7
Yep the windows and the doors you can get from all the main suppliers and even on ebay if you want to mess arond to get the to fit our 7's.

If you go to car builders solutions there is an air con unit on there you can get, but I know it costs a bit. That is the only universal one I know of though. The unit also replaces the old heater we have, so may be good if you want to save space and weight.

I also know that cruse control is out there, but sure it costs a arm and a leg lol.
